A senior Nvidia optical-interconnect executive has joined European optoelectronics firm ams OSRAM as VP/GM of optical interconnects — a move the industry reads as VCSEL mounting a direct challenge to silicon photonics in the AI data-center race.

Who is this executive, and why does the move matter?

M. Ashkan Seyedi spent years leading Nvidia's optical-interconnect efforts and is widely regarded as a key technical figure in the field.
His doctoral work focused on high-speed optoelectronic devices in InGaAsP and GaN material systems — the core materials behind VCSELs (vertical-cavity surface-emitting lasers, tiny semiconductor lasers that emit light directly from a chip surface).
This means → he is not a generic management hire. He is carrying deep, foundational expertise from the silicon-photonics camp into the VCSEL camp.

What does ams OSRAM plan to do with him?

ams OSRAM is a European optoelectronics chipmaker and one of the world's leading VCSEL suppliers.
Seyedi takes the role of VP and GM of optical interconnects, stating he will drive the company's "digital photonics strategy" and build next-generation micro-emitter solutions for AI data centers.
In plain terms = the company wants to use its VCSEL strengths to compete head-on in the AI data-center optical-interconnect market — a space currently dominated by silicon photonics.

What exactly are VCSEL and silicon photonics fighting over?

The battleground is CPO — co-packaged optics, a design that places optical modules directly inside the chip package to shorten signal paths and cut power consumption.
Silicon photonics (transmitting optical signals through silicon) has long dominated the CPO narrative; its supply chain is more mature.
VCSEL (emitting light directly from compound semiconductors) offers potential cost and power-efficiency advantages but lags in productization.
This means → the two are not complementary paths. They are competing for the same slice of the fast-growing AI data-center market.

What does top-talent movement signal?

Tech analysis account Irrational Analysis commented: "If you work in optics, you know who this is and how big a deal this is."
Where elite talent goes has historically been a leading indicator of which technology roadmap gains traction — money and people moving in the same direction signals stronger industrial backing.
Yet X user Jukan remarked, "Glad I didn't buy any photonics stocks" — this reflects a view among some market participants that the unresolved technology-path uncertainty is itself an investment risk, with no clear winner yet.
